Creating inclusive STEM coding clubs is essential to ensure that all youth, regardless of their background, have access to opportunities in technology and innovation. These clubs can inspire a diverse range of students to pursue careers in science, technology, engineering, and mathematics.
Understanding the Importance of Diversity in STEM
Diversity in STEM fields leads to a variety of perspectives and innovative solutions. When coding clubs are inclusive, they help break down barriers that might prevent underrepresented groups from participating, such as gender biases, socioeconomic challenges, or lack of access to resources.
Strategies for Creating Inclusive Coding Clubs
- Promote a welcoming environment: Use inclusive language and celebrate diverse backgrounds.
- Provide accessible resources: Ensure that all students have access to necessary technology and learning materials.
- Offer mentorship opportunities: Connect students with mentors from diverse backgrounds in STEM fields.
- Incorporate culturally relevant content: Use examples and projects that reflect students’ experiences and interests.
- Encourage collaboration: Foster teamwork among students from different backgrounds to build mutual respect and understanding.
Implementing Inclusive Practices
Effective implementation involves ongoing reflection and adaptation. Teachers and club leaders should seek feedback from participants to identify barriers and develop strategies to address them. Creating a safe space where all students feel valued encourages sustained engagement and enthusiasm for STEM.
